{"id":1307,"date":"2025-10-13T13:11:32","date_gmt":"2025-10-13T11:11:32","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/science-x.net\/?p=1307"},"modified":"2025-10-13T13:11:34","modified_gmt":"2025-10-13T11:11:34","slug":"how-to-clean-your-home-properly-and-the-best-gadgets-to-help-you","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/science-x.net\/?p=1307","title":{"rendered":"How to Clean Your Home Properly and the Best Gadgets to Help You"},"content":{"rendered":"\n<p>A clean and organized home is not only visually pleasing but also essential for health, focus, and emotional balance. Regular cleaning reduces dust, allergens, and bacteria, while also creating a calm, productive environment. Today, modern technology offers countless smart gadgets that make home cleaning faster, easier, and even enjoyable.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Step-by-Step Guide to Effective Cleaning<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>A good cleaning routine begins with a <strong>plan<\/strong>. The key is to move from top to bottom and from less dirty areas to the dirtiest ones. This ensures that dust or debris doesn\u2019t fall onto freshly cleaned surfaces.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ol>\n<li><strong>Declutter first.<\/strong> Remove unnecessary items from floors, tables, and countertops. It\u2019s easier to clean when the space is clear.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Dust and wipe surfaces.<\/strong> Use microfiber cloths or electrostatic dusters to trap particles instead of spreading them around.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Vacuum and mop floors.<\/strong> Always vacuum before mopping to prevent spreading dust and hair.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Disinfect high-touch areas.<\/strong> Door handles, switches, and remotes harbor bacteria and should be cleaned regularly.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Refresh fabrics.<\/strong> Wash curtains, pillowcases, and bed linens at least once every two weeks.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<p>Cleaning becomes more efficient when you divide tasks by zones \u2014 kitchen, bathroom, living room, and bedrooms \u2014 instead of trying to tackle everything at once.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Modern Gadgets That Simplify Cleaning<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Technology has made home maintenance more effortless than ever. Here are some of the best devices to keep your home spotless: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Robot Vacuum Cleaners:<\/strong> Devices like the <em>iRobot Roomba<\/em> or <em>Xiaomi Roborock<\/em> automatically clean floors, navigate around obstacles, and recharge themselves.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Robot Mops:<\/strong> Some models combine vacuuming and mopping in one, perfect for tiled or laminate floors.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Cordless Vacuum Cleaners:<\/strong> Lightweight and portable, these make cleaning stairs and furniture much easier.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Steam Cleaners:<\/strong> Use high-temperature steam to disinfect surfaces without chemicals \u2014 ideal for kitchens and bathrooms.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Air Purifiers:<\/strong> Continuously filter dust, pollen, and pet dander, improving indoor air quality.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Ultrasonic Cleaning Devices:<\/strong> Great for delicate items like jewelry, glasses, or small metal tools.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Smart Trash Bins:<\/strong> Automatically open with motion sensors and compact waste efficiently.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Eco-Friendly and Safe Cleaning Tips<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>To protect your health and the environment, avoid harsh chemical cleaners whenever possible. Natural alternatives like <strong>baking soda<\/strong>, <strong>vinegar<\/strong>, and <strong>lemon juice<\/strong> effectively clean and disinfect most surfaces. Reusable microfiber cloths and biodegradable sponges help reduce waste. Always ventilate rooms after cleaning to remove fumes and humidity.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Organizing for Long-Term Cleanliness<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Cleanliness isn\u2019t just about scrubbing \u2014 it\u2019s about creating a space that stays neat longer. Keep storage boxes for small items, use vertical shelves to maximize space, and assign each item a permanent place. Setting aside just <strong>10 minutes a day<\/strong> for small cleaning tasks prevents the buildup of dirt and clutter.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Benefits of a Clean Home<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>A tidy home supports both <strong>mental and physical health<\/strong>. Studies show that people living in organized environments experience less stress and sleep better. Clean air, dust-free surfaces, and sanitized kitchens also lower the risk of allergies and infections. Moreover, a well-kept home reflects mindfulness and care, fostering harmony among all family members.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Interesting Facts<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ul>\n<li>The average household collects nearly <strong>18 kilograms of dust per year<\/strong>.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Steam cleaning can kill up to <strong>99.9% of bacteria<\/strong> without chemicals.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Robotic vacuums can map your home using AI and even schedule cleaning when you\u2019re away.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Lemon juice and baking soda can clean stainless steel and remove odors naturally.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Glossary<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ul>\n<li><strong><em>Microfiber<\/em><\/strong> \u2014 a fine synthetic fiber that effectively captures dust and dirt.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ong><em>HEPA filter<\/em><\/strong> \u2014 a high-efficiency air filter that traps microscopic particles and allergens.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ong><em>Steam cleaning<\/em><\/strong> \u2014 cleaning method using hot vapor to sanitize surfaces.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ong><em>Decluttering<\/em><\/strong> \u2014 the process of removing unnecessary items to create order and space.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ong><em>Eco-friendly<\/em><\/strong> \u2014 safe for the environment and health, using natural or non-toxic materials.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>A clean and organized home is not only visually pleasing but also essential for health, focus, and emotional balance.
